How Does the Mines Game Work?

The Mines game is a simple yet captivating casino game that is based on the classic Minesweeper game. In this game, players are presented with a grid of tiles, some of which contain hidden mines. The goal of the game is to reveal all the tiles on the grid without uncovering a mine. Players can choose the size of the grid and the number of mines hidden within it, which will impact the difficulty level of the game. To uncover a tile, players simply click on it, and if they reveal a mine, the game is over. If they successfully reveal all non-mine tiles, they win the game and can collect their winnings. RTP and Volatility Analysis

When it comes to the Mines game, understanding the RTP (Return to Player) and volatility is crucial for maximizing your chances of winning. The RTP of the Mines game typically ranges from 96% to 98%, which means that, on average, players can expect to receive back 96 to 98 credits for every 100 credits wagered over the long term. This makes the Mines game a relatively attractive option for players looking to stretch their bankroll further. However, it is important to note that the RTP is calculated over a large uk casino not on gamstop number of game rounds, so individual results can vary widely. In terms of volatility, the Mines game is considered to have medium to high volatility, which means that players may experience some fluctuations in their winnings.

KYC vs No-KYC Systems

One important aspect to consider when playing the Mines game at a non gamstop casino is the KYC (Know Your Customer) requirements. KYC is a set of guidelines that casinos must follow to verify the identity of their players and prevent money laundering and fraud. Some non gamstop casinos have strict KYC procedures in place, requiring players to submit documents such as a passport or driver’s license to verify their identity before they can withdraw their winnings. On the other hand, some casinos offer a No-KYC option, which allows players to play and withdraw their winnings without having to go through the stringent verification process. While No-KYC casinos offer a more streamlined experience, they may pose higher risks in terms of security and player protection.
